In an audio optocoupler, the audio signal is amplified and adjusted to be converted into a current signal, which drives the light-emitting diode to emit the corresponding light signal. This optical signal will be transmitted to the receiving end through optical fibers or other optical conductors. At the receiving end, the photoresistor converts the optical signal back into an electrical signal, which is then amplified and restored to obtain the original audio signal. The main function of an audio optocoupler is to achieve mutual conversion and transmission between electrical and optical signals. It has the characteristics of strong anti-interference, long transmission distance, and good signal transmission quality. Therefore, in some special application scenarios, such as environments where audio signal transmission distances are long or anti-interference is required, audio optocouplers can play a good role
